Choi Ming-da is a key figure in Hong Kong's pro-democracy movement and one of the operators of the social media channel 'Tuesdayroad'. He has gained attention for his activism and engagement with the youth in Hong Kong, and he is currently targeted by Hong Kong authorities, who have offered a cash reward for information leading to his arrest.
